SENEY AREA UPDATE via Seney Snowmobile Association >> What an incredible day at the 22nd Annual Snowmobile Vet Ride! πŸ‡ΊπŸ‡Έβ„οΈ
Thank you to everyone who came out to support this amazing event. We had 305 total riders, including 95 Veterans, join us for a day filled with camaraderie, gratitude, and great trail riding.
A very special thank you to the Newberry Post Honor Guard for helping us honor our Veterans in such a meaningful and respectful way. Your presence added so much to the day and reminded us all why this event is so important.
We are so grateful to our volunteers, ride guides, groomer operators, sponsors, and everyone who helped make this day possible. Seeing all the snowmoilers come together to support and celebrate our Veterans is what this ride is all about.
We are incredibly proud to host this event each year and can never thank our Veterans enough for their service and sacrifice.
Already looking forward to next year! β€οΈπŸ€πŸ’™
